Rare Disease Genetic Testing Market

Rare Disease Genetic Testing Market

The Rare Disease Genetic Testing Market reached USD 1.18 billion in 2025 and is expected to reach USD 3.29 billion by 2033, growing at a CAGR of 13.7% during the forecast period 2026-2033.

Growth is driven by increasing prevalence and awareness of rare genetic disorders, along with rising demand for early and accurate diagnostic solutions. Genetic testing plays a crucial role in identifying rare diseases, enabling personalized treatment approaches, and improving patient outcomes. Additionally, advancements in next-generation sequencing (NGS), molecular diagnostics, and bioinformatics, along with growing investments in genomics research and precision medicine, are accelerating market expansion. Supportive government initiatives, improved access to genetic counseling services, and the expansion of newborn screening programs are further fueling the global growth of the rare disease genetic testing market.

✦ Market Segmentation
By Type
The market is segmented into Neurological Disorders 28%, Metabolic Diseases 18%, Hematology Diseases 15%, Immunological Disorders 12%, Musculoskeletal Disorders 10%, Endocrine Disorders 9%, and Others 8%, with neurological disorders leading due to the high prevalence of genetically inherited neurological conditions. Increasing awareness and early diagnosis initiatives are supporting growth across all disease types. Advances in genomics are improving detection rates for complex rare diseases.

By Technology
The market includes Next-Generation Sequencing (NGS) 40%, PCR-Based Testing 18%, Array Technology 14%, FISH 10%, Sanger Sequencing 8%, Karyotyping 6%, and Others 4%, with NGS dominating due to its high accuracy, scalability, and ability to analyze multiple genes simultaneously. PCR-based testing remains widely used for targeted diagnostics. Emerging technologies are enhancing speed and cost-efficiency in genetic testing.

By Specialty
The market is segmented into Molecular Genetic Tests 55%, Chromosomal Genetic Tests 30%, and Biochemical Genetic Tests 15%, with molecular tests leading due to their precision in identifying gene mutations associated with rare diseases. Chromosomal testing is essential for detecting structural abnormalities. Biochemical tests support diagnosis by analyzing enzyme activity and metabolic functions.

By End-User
The market includes Diagnostic Laboratories 40%, Hospitals 30%, Research Laboratories 20%, and Others 10%, with diagnostic laboratories dominating due to high testing volumes and specialized capabilities. Hospitals are increasingly integrating genetic testing into clinical workflows. Research laboratories play a key role in innovation and development of advanced diagnostic techniques.

✦ Regional Analysis
North America - 38% Share
North America dominates the market due to advanced healthcare infrastructure and strong adoption of genetic testing technologies. The United States leads with significant investments in genomics research and precision medicine. Favorable reimbursement policies and awareness programs support market growth.

Europe - 27% Share
Europe holds a significant share driven by government initiatives and increasing focus on rare disease diagnosis. Countries like Germany, the UK, and France are key contributors. The region emphasizes early detection and access to advanced diagnostic solutions.

Asia-Pacific - 20% Share
Asia-Pacific is witnessing rapid growth due to expanding healthcare infrastructure and increasing awareness of genetic disorders. Countries such as China, Japan, and India are investing in genomics and diagnostic technologies. Rising patient population is driving demand.
